About this sailing

Depart Yokohama for Nagoya before sailing south to Ibusuki, known for its Chiran Samurai street and Kamikaze Museum, and Sasebo, for its Hirado Castle and Tabira church. Continue to Jeju Island in South Korea, then arrive in Hakata, gateway to northern Kyushu. Cherry blossom viewing is subject to natural weather conditions and cannot be guaranteed. Bloom times may vary and are beyond Mitsui Ocean Cruises' control. Port sequence, places visited, tours and times may be different from those published. Ibusuki

Ibusuki, on the southern tip of Kyushu, is famous for its natural hot springs and unique sand baths, where you are gently buried in warm, geothermal sand. This laid-back port is ideal for experiencing Japan’s onsen culture in a relaxed coastal setting. Between visits to bathhouses, enjoy views of Kagoshima Bay and the surrounding volcanic landscape. The day offers a balance of wellness, gentle exploration, and time to soak in the tranquil atmosphere.

Sasebo

Sasebo is a scenic harbor city on Kyushu known for its beautiful bays, nearby islands, and maritime history. From the port, you can explore viewpoints over the Kujukushima ("99 Islands"), stroll the waterfront, or visit local markets and cafés. The city has a relaxed, international feel due to its long naval heritage, offering an interesting contrast to larger Japanese ports. Look forward to coastal panoramas and a comfortable, medium-paced day ashore.

Jeju

Jeju Island, just off the coast of South Korea, is renowned for its dramatic volcanic landscapes, rugged coastlines, and subtropical ambience. Depending on your chosen excursion, you might visit waterfalls, lava cliffs, or traditional villages dotted with stone walls and tangerine groves. The island’s fresh sea air and sweeping ocean views make this port a scenic highlight of the voyage. Expect a day of impressive natural scenery, plenty of photo opportunities, and a taste of Korean culture.
